Full Job Description
Job Title: Mechanical Engineer- Cheyenne, WY

Work Location:F.E. Warren AFB (Cheyenne, WY)

Salary: Based on experience and will be discussed with manager in interview

REQUIREMENT- Must be a US Citizen and must pass a federal background review and drug screen

Duties/Responsibilities:
  • Candidate will provide engineering services on several simultaneous federal projects ranging in value up from tens of millions to hundreds of millions of dollars in construction value.
  • Experience with large Federal Building Design and Construction Projects, or other similarly complex projects is desired. For this requirement, "Large" projects are defined as a construction value of at least $100 million or more.
  • Candidate will be responsible for site observation and reporting on multiple assigned projects to government personnel.
  • Candidate will provide technical and administrative support.
  • Oversee construction, contract administration, and quality assurance activities in accordance with established policies, procedures, and regulations.
  • Analyze design and construction issues with respect to contract requirements.
  • Deliver recommendations to government personnel regarding compliance with contract provisions.
  • Candidate should be prepared to review and interpret plans and specifications, submittals, reports, schedules, modifications, cost estimates, pay applications, change orders and claims.
  • Provide field surveillance and prepare daily detailed reports covering all pertinent factors affecting cost and engineering considerations.
  • Participate in pre-construction conferences with government personnel.
  • Emphasis is placed on knowledge and experience with but not limited to HVAC systems, system controls, building automation, chilled water, plumbing, humidification, data centers, and other complex mechanical-engineering related elements found in large and complex buildings and utility plants.

Education/Experience:
  • Bachelors of Science in Mechanical Engineering or related field from an accredited college
  • Minimum of 10 years of engineering; construction and contract administration experience.
  • Registered Professional Engineer (P.E.) preferred
  • US Army Corps of Engineering (USACE) or other federal project experience, preferred
  • Experience using RMS 3.0, preferred
  • Demonstrate proficiency and effective communications skills in the English language in both oral and written forms
  • Interaction with clients and contractors requires candidate to have a professional presentation along with excellent communication skills and attention to detail.
